How to Make German Chocolate Cake

Ingredients: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 cups sugar
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 1 cup shredded coconut
  • 1 cup chopped pecans
  • Frosting (double the recipe for extra) – chocolate frosting or German chocolate frosting

Step-by-Step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ans.
  2. In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, baking powder,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
  4. Gradually add the flour mixture and buttermilk alternately to the creamed mixture, beginning and ending with the flour. Mix until just combined.
  5. Divide the batter evenly between the prepared pans and smooth the tops.
  6.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  7. Allow the cakes to cool in the pans for 10 minutes, then transfer to wire racks to cool completely.
  8. While the cakes are cooling, prepare the frosting of your choice.
  9. Once the cakes are cooled, frost the tops and sides of the layers with the frosting.
  10. For extra frosting, double the frosting recipe for a thicker layer. Enjoy the cake as is, or spread leftover frosting on graham crackers or brownies.

How to Store German Chocolate Cake

To store your German Chocolate Cake, keep it in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you need to store it for longer, place it in the refrigerator where it can last for up to a week. For longer storage, you can freeze the cake.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il, and freeze for as long as three months. Thaw it in the refrigerator before serving.

Tips to Make German Chocolate Cake Perfect

  1. Room Temperature Ingredients: Ensure your butter, eggs, and buttermilk are at room temperature. This helps create a smooth batter and ensures even baking.
  2. Don’t Overmix the Batter: Mix until just combined to avoid a dense cake.
  3. Check for Doneness Early: Ovens vary, so start checking your cakes a few minutes before the recommended baking time.
  4. Use Fresh Ingredients: Ensure your baking powder and baking soda are fresh for optimal rising.
  5. Frosting Layers: For a more impressive cake, use frosting in the middle layers as well as the top and sides.

FAQs 

What makes a cake “German”?

The term “German” in German Chocolate Cake refers to a specific type of dark-baking chocolate, named after an American named Samuel German, who developed it in 1852. It is not related to Germany itself.

Can I use regular chocolate instead of German chocolate?

Yes, you can use regular semi-sweet or dark chocolate instead of German chocolate. However, German chocolate has a distinct sweetness and a complex flavor that adds a unique touch to the cake.

How can I make the cake gluten-free?

To make a gluten-free version of German Chocolate Cake, replace all-purpose flour with a gluten-free all-purpose flour blend. Ensure that your other ingredients, like baking powder and baking soda, are also gluten-free.
